Aston Villa release Orjan Nyland

Aston Villa announce the departure of goalkeeper Orjan Nyland by mutual consent after the 30-year-old fell down the pecking order at Villa Park.

Aston Villa have announced the departure of goalkeeper Orjan Nyland by mutual consent.

The 30-year-old joined the West Midlands outfit from Ingolstadt in 2018 and went on to make 35 appearances for the club in all competitions.

However, following the arrival of Emiliano Martinez from Arsenal, Nyland fell down the pecking order at Villa Park and turned out just once for Dean Smith's side this season - a 3-1 victory against Burton Albion in the EFL Cup.

Now the Norwegian has become the second player in Aston Villa's side to terminate their contract by mutual agreement, with Jota signing for Deportivo Alaves after an underwhelming spell at Villa Park.

Nyland's departure leaves Jed Steer, Tom Heaton and Lovre Kalinic as backups to Martinez for Dean Smith at Aston Villa, who currently sit second in the Premier League table.
